Precautionary suspension of SA Tourism CEO unlawful: De Lille


Tourism Minister Patricia De Lille says the precautionary suspension of the SA Tourism CEO Nombulelo Guliwe is unlawful.

The Board of South African Tourism has placed Guliwe on precautionary suspension effective immediately, following serious allegations of misconduct.

However, De Lille says the board cannot suspend Guliwe as there is no chairperson nor deputy chairperson.

“I have been advised by my legal team, this decision by the SA Tourism Board is unlawful. As of 31 July 2025, the South African Tourism Board, does not have a board chairperson following the resignation of Professor Gregory Davids. This means, the board in its current form is not properly constituted to take such a resolution.”
